About the Role
We're looking for an experienced Machine Operator to join our team. You'll play a key role in delivering demolition projects of all sizes. This position requires someone who can work independently, operate machinery confidently, and isn't afraid to get stuck in. You'll follow instructions from the Site Manager and ensure all tasks are completed safely and efficiently.
Key Responsibilities
- Safely operate a range of equipment in line with company safety policies and procedures
- Competently handle tasks such as loading trucks and loading machinery onto transport vehicles
- Maintain, clean, and store company equipment and materials in a safe and organized manner
- Stay organized and ensure both you and your equipment are prepared and transported efficiently to and from work.
- Show strong time management, think on your feet, balance tasks effectively, and maintain a high level of safety awareness.
- Complete daily pre-start checks on all machines and ensure supporting paperwork is accurate
- Accurately complete all required documentation, including check sheets, charge-out dockets, daily run sheets, timesheets, and any other operational paperwork
Skills, Experience & Attributes:
- Hold a current WTR Endorsements and/or Class 4/5 Licence
- Successful track record operating heavy machinery; loaders and excavators, as well as smaller equipment
- Preferably experience with 14t and above machinery
- Mechanically minded
- A safe and responsible approach to work as well as health and safety
- You Must already be eligible to work in New Zealand to be considered for this Job
- Be open to working abroad for short periods
- Applicants must be drug free, punctual and hardworking
- Available to start immediately
- Familiar with the demolition industry and the safety requirements within.
- A good attitude, and proven history of driving and operating safely
- Valid Site Safe card would be beneficial but not essential
